About the Fund Manager
Jason Pidcock
Located in: London
May 1996 - Aug 2004 Fund manager - BP Investment Management
Dec 1993 - May 1996 Assistant fund manager - Henderson Global Investors
Jason has nearly 11 years experience of investing in the Pacific ex-Japan stock markets. In his last role with BP Jason was responsible for managing the majority of the Pacific ex-Japan portion of the BP pension fund. This Fund is around £10 billion in size and the allocation to the Pacific ex-Japan region was around 5% (around £500 million) Jason was responsible for stock selection and asset allocation in Hong Kong, China, Australia, Singapore, Malaysia, Thailand, Indonesia and the Philippines, while his colleague covered Korea, India and Taiwan.
As the numbers detailed below show Jason has an excellent performance track record against both his benchmark and his peer group. Over the past 3 years the Pacific ex-Japan portion contributed the most in the way of performance to the BP Fund.
